Помощник ИИ для ваших задач Todoist.
Todoist GPT Assistant-это сценарий Python, предназначенный для предоставления вам предложений, сгенерированных AI, которые помогут вам заполнить список дел. Этот сценарий подключается к вашей учетной записи Todoist, извлекает ваши последние задачи и использует расширенные модели OpenAI (включая GPT-4 и GPT-3.5-Turbo), чтобы создать пошаговые инструкции о том, как их выполнить. Обратите внимание, что этот сценарий может обновить описания ваших задач с помощью этих предложений. Он также может быть настроен для обновления задач, которые приходится на сегодня, надпись или задачи, которые еще не имеют описания GPT. Рекомендуется использовать эту функцию с осторожностью, чтобы избежать каких -либо неожиданных изменений в описаниях ваших задач. С помощью Todoist GPT Assistant вы можете легко оставаться в верхней части своего списка дел и оптимизировать свою производительность.
Клонировать этот репозиторий или загрузите исходный код. Установите требуемые зависимости, используя PIP:
pip install openai configparser todoist_api_python colorama argparse tqdm
Настройте файл todoist-config.ini в каталоге проекта со следующей структурой:
[todoist]
api_key = YOUR_TODOIST_API_KEY
[openai]
api_key = YOUR_OPENAI_API_KEY
Замените заполнители вашим соответствующим клавишами API.
Запустите сценарий, выполнив:
python todoist_gpt_assistant.py
Вы также можете передать следующие аргументы командной строки:
python todoist_gpt_assistant.py -u
python todoist_gpt_assistant.py -i
python todoist_gpt_assistant.py -d
-u,-update-all: обновить все описания задач, которые еще не были обновлены
-i, - -Interactive: включить интерактивный режим
-d,-due-today: только задачи обновления, которые просроченные или сегодня

Задача: публикуйте Todoist GPT Assistant Python Script в GitHub и напишите readme
GPT-3.5-Turbo Предложение: чтобы опубликовать ассистент Python Todoist GPT-ассистентный сценарий Python и написать Readme, выполните эти шаги:
Создайте учетную запись GitHub и репозиторий. Установите git на свой компьютер. Откройте свой терминал или командную строку и перейдите в каталог, где находится ваш сценарий. Инициализируйте репозиторий GIT с командой «git init». Добавьте свой сценарий в репозиторий с помощью команды «git add». Соберите свои изменения с помощью команды "GIT Commit -m" Первоначальный коммит ". Добавьте URL удаленного репозитория в свой локальный репозиторий с помощью команды «git remote добавить происхождение». Вставьте свои изменения в удаленный репозиторий с помощью команды «GIT Push -u Origin Master». Создайте файл readme.md в своем хранилище и добавьте информацию о сценарии, такую как его цель, как его использовать, и любые зависимости. Сделайте и встаньте свои изменения в репозиторий с помощью команд «git add readme.md» и «git commit -m» добавить readme.md '».
Задача: купить продукты
Предложение GPT-3.5-Turbo: Создайте список покупок со всеми предметами, которые вам нужны, организованные по категории. Посетите близлежащий продуктовый магазин в непиковые часы, чтобы избежать толпы. Придерживайтесь своего списка и используйте корзину или корзину для ношения ваших предметов. Проверьте даты истечения срока действия и выберите свежие продукты. Оплатите у кассира и принесите многоразовые сумки за экологически чистые покупки.
Задача: закончить презентацию.
GPT-3,5-Turbo Предложение: разбивайте задачу на более мелкие шаги: 1) Ориентируйте презентацию, включая ключевые моменты и вспомогательные аргументы. 2) Соберите соответствующие данные и визуальные эффекты для поддержки ваших аргументов. 3) Создать слайды с постоянным дизайном, используя пули точек
Если вы хотите внести свой вклад в проект или иметь какие -либо предложения, не стесняйтесь создавать запрос на тягу или открыть проблему. Все взносы приветствуются!
Этот инструмент не имеет отношения к компании Todoist Company и является хобби -проектом.
Этот проект лицензирован по лицензии MIT. Смотрите файл лицензии для получения подробной информации.
Напоминание: Программное обеспечение предоставляется «как есть», без каких -либо гарантий любого рода, явного или подразумеваемого, включая, помимо прочего, гарантии товарной пригодности, пригодности для определенной цели и неинфляции. Ни в коем случае авторы или владельцы авторских прав не будут нести ответственность за любые претензии, убытки или другую ответственность, будь то в действии контракта, деликт или иным образом, возникающие из или в связи с программным обеспечением или использованием или другими сделками в программном обеспечении.